Multi Jet Fusion (MJF) 3D Printing

Multi Jet Fusion (MJF) is one of the most versatile and efficient 3D printing technologies available today, offering exceptional precision, strength, and surface quality. This guide walks you through the key design considerations, best practices, and tips to help you create optimized parts for MJF. Whether you’re prototyping, producing functional components, or scaling up to full production, understanding these design guidelines will ensure your parts are printed accurately and perform as intended.

Explore HP Multi Jet Fusion (MJF) an advanced additive manufacturing technology that fuses nylon powder with precise thermal energy to create strong, functional parts. Learn about how MJF differs from other powder bed fusion methods through its fast-printing speeds, excellent mechanical properties, and fine feature resolution.
